Forum Financial Management LP Grows Stock Holdings in Stanley Black & Decker, Inc. (NYSE:SWK)

Forum Financial Management LP lifted its position in Stanley Black & Decker, Inc. (NYSE:SWKFree Report) by 88.0% in the fourth qu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The firm owned 4,814 shares of the industrial products company’s stock after purchasing an additional 2,253 shares during the quarter. Forum Financial Management LP’s holdings in Stanley Black & Decker were worth $387,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Stanley Black & Decker Price Performance

SWK stock opened at $57.08 on Monday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.64, a current ratio of 1.30 and a quick ratio of 0.37. Stanley Black & Decker, Inc. has a 1 year low of $53.91 and a 1 year high of $110.88. The firm has a 50-day moving average of $76.67 and a 200 day moving average of $85.03. The company has a market cap of $8.82 billion, a P/E ratio of 29.42, a PEG ratio of 1.33 and a beta of 1.14.

Stanley Black & Decker (NYSE:SWKG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, February 5th. The industrial products company reported $1.49 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.28 by $0.21. Stanley Black & Decker had a return on equity of 7.50% and a net margin of 1.92%. On average, sell-side analysts forecast that Stanley Black & Decker, Inc. will post 5.16 EPS for the current year.

Stanley Black & Decker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, March 18th. Stockholders of record on Tuesday, March 4th were given a $0.82 dividend. This represents a $3.28 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 5.75%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Tuesday, March 4th. Stanley Black & Decker’s dividend payout ratio is presently 169.07%.

Stanley Black & Decker Company Profile

(Free Report)

Stanley Black & Decker, Inc engages in the provision of power and hand tools, and related accessories, products, services and equipment for oil and gas, infrastructure applications, commercial electronic security and monitoring systems, healthcare solutions, and mechanical access solutions. It operates through the Tools and Outdoor and Industrial segments.
